.hero_hero__f3x_t{display:grid;grid-template-columns:repeat(7,100px);grid-template-rows:repeat(4,100px);grid-column-gap:20px;column-gap:20px;grid-row-gap:20px;row-gap:20px;margin:3rem 0 5rem;@media screen and (max-width:870px){grid-template-columns:repeat(7,11vw);grid-template-rows:repeat(4,11vw);column-gap:2.2vw;row-gap:2.2vw}}.hero_outer__3gb_C{overflow:hidden;@media screen and (max-width:870px){border-radius:2.2vw}}.hero_inner__oeENm{width:100%;height:100%;background-size:cover;transition:transform .2s;.hero_outer__3gb_C:hover &{transform:scale(1.1) rotate(-5deg)}}.page_page__ZU32B{h1{text-align:center;font-size:2.8rem;line-height:.9;margin:2rem 0;span{font-size:1.8rem}}h2{color:transparent;background-image:linear-gradient(26deg,var(--p1) 0,var(--p5) 100%);-webkit-background-clip:text;background-clip:text;text-align:center}}